A static Next.js sign-up screen shipped as a shadcn registry TSX block. It presents email, Google, and GitHub choices but supplies no authentication logic. The source depends on next/link, Tailwind theme utilities, and Tailark-provided Logo, Button, Input, and Label components.

Verdict

Do not adopt the current registry entry unchanged. The build fails because the Tailark Veil button dependency resolves to a missing registry resource, so the component never mounts. After repairing that reference, it still needs a shadcn-style setup and application-owned authentication behavior.

Use it if

  • You want a compact account creation screen and will connect every action to your own authentication flow.
  • Your app already uses Next.js, Tailwind theme tokens, and shadcn-style component aliases.
  • You are prepared to replace or manually source the broken Tailark button dependency.

Skip it if

  • You need a registry block that installs and builds without repairing dependency references.
  • Your product needs working social sign-in or form submission behavior out of the box.
  • Your stack is not Next.js and you do not want to replace its Link component and import aliases.
  • You require verified runtime or accessibility behavior, since the component never reached the mount stage.

In a non-shadcn project, add Tailwind utilities and matching theme tokens, configure the component import alias, and provide local Logo, Button, Input, and Label equivalents. Use Next.js Link or replace it with your router. Manually repair or replace the missing Veil button registry dependency, then wire form submission and social authentication.
